More about station hand courses in South Australia

Embarking on a career as a station hand in South Australia is an exciting opportunity, and there are numerous Station Hand courses in South Australia designed to equip you with essential skills. With 12 beginner courses available, you can choose from various options that cater to your interests and career goals. For instance, the Certificate II in Agriculture AHC20122 offers foundational knowledge, while the Certificate III in Agriculture AHC30122 delves deeper into the industry. These courses are perfect for those seeking practical, hands-on training in a supportive learning environment.

Learning from experienced professionals is a crucial aspect of these training programs. Notable providers such as CL, which teaches the Operate Machinery and Equipment course, and Link Resources are committed to helping you succeed in your studies. The combination of theoretical knowledge and practical skills will prepare you for various roles within the agricultural landscape of South Australia, from pest control techniques learned in the Apply Poison Baits for Vertebrate Pest Control course to the operational training provided in the Operate Side By Side Utility Vehicles course.

South Australia is renowned for its vast agricultural industry, and completing a course such as the Certificate II in Shearing AHC21316 or the Certificate III in Dairy Production AHC30221 can open doors to a rewarding career in this vibrant sector. Whether you are interested in livestock management or crop production, these Station Hand courses in South Australia will provide the knowledge and skills needed to thrive.

Additionally, you may consider specialised options such as the Game Harvester Skill Set AMPSS00018 or the Course in Minimising Risks in the Use of 1080 & PAPP Bait Products. These tailored courses address specific aspects of the agricultural and wildlife management fields, ensuring that learners are well-rounded and versatile. With the right qualifications, you'll be well-prepared to contribute positively to South Australia's agricultural landscape and step confidently into your new career as a station hand.
